What Market Size Is Forecasted For The In-Vitro Toxicology Testing Market By 2030 Based On Its 2026 Value?
The in-vitro toxicology testing market has experienced significant expansion in its size over recent years. This market is projected to expand from $12.73 billion in 2025 to $14.11 billion in 2026,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 10.9%. Historically, this growth can be attributed to several factors including ethical concerns over animal testing, an increase in pharmaceutical research and development activity, the early adoption of cell-based assays, regulatory restrictions on animal testing, and the growth in cosmetic safety testing.
The in-vitro toxicology testing market is projected to experience substantial expansion in the coming years. This market is anticipated to reach a valuation of $20.87 billion by 2030,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 10.3%. This anticipated growth throughout the forecast period stems from factors such as progress in toxicogenomics and predictive modeling, a heightened need for safety testing in personalized medicine, increased capital allocation to alternative testing methods, the proliferation of regulatory guidelines that endorse in vitro techniques, and the expansion of biotechnology and biopharmaceutical product development pipelines. Key trends expected during this period involve a growing transition from in vivo to in vitro toxicology approaches, wider implementation of high-throughput screening technologies, a heightened necessity for toxicity evaluation at the early stages of drug discovery, the proliferation of cell-based and organ-on-chip assays, and an increasing embrace of alternative toxicology methods by regulatory bodies.

What Primary Factors Are Fueling The Expansion Of The In-Vitro Toxicology Testing Market?
The in-vitro toxicology testing market is anticipated to be propelled by increasing healthcare expenditure. Healthcare expenditure signifies the financial resources allocated by individuals and the government from their total income towards medical facilities, at-home health services, prescription drugs, nursing homes, and personal healthcare. Global health expenditure is expanding due to the rising occurrence of diseases, which necessitates the use of in-vitro toxicology testing. For example, a report published in September 2024 by the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services, a federal agency based in the US, indicates that the national health expenditure (NHE) is projected to have an average growth rate of 5.6% from 2023 to 2032, surpassing the average GDP growth rate of 4.3%. Consequently, the share of health spending as a percentage of GDP is expected to increase from 17.3% in 2022 to 19.7% in 2032. Therefore, the growth in healthcare expenditure is a key driver for the in-vitro toxicology testing market.
Which Segment Groups Define The In-Vitro Toxicology Testing Market Landscape?
The in-vitro toxicology testing market covered in this report is segmented –
1) By Product And Service: Consumables, Assays, Equipment, Software, Services
2) By Technology: Cell Culture Technologies, High-throughput Technologies, Toxicogenomics
3) By Applications: Neurotoxicity, Dermal toxicity, Cytotoxicity, Other Applications
4) By Industry: Pharmaceuticals And Biopharmaceuticals, Cosmetic And Household Products, Food, Chemicals
Subsegments:
1) By Consumables: Reagents, Cell Culture Media, Plates And Vials
2) By Assays: Cell-Based Assays, Biochemical Assays, Genetic Toxicity Assays
3) By Equipment: Automated Systems, Microscopes, Plate Readers
4) By Software: Data Analysis Software, Laboratory Information Management Systems (LIMS), Toxicology Modeling Software
5) By Services: Testing Services, Consultation Services, Regulatory Compliance Services
What Trends Are Influencing The In-Vitro Toxicology Testing Market?
Key companies within the in-vitro toxicology testing market are adopting a strategic partnership approach to offer inhalation toxicology tests, thereby strengthening their market position. Strategic partnerships are defined as a collaborative process where companies leverage each other’s strengths and resources to achieve mutual benefits and success. For example, in November 2024, Charles River Laboratories International Inc., a US-based provider of pharmaceutical products and services, collaborated with MatTek Life Sciences, a US-based biotechnology company, to develop a new approach methodology (NAM) for inhalation toxicology testing aimed at reducing dependence on traditional animal research methods. By incorporating MatTek’s advanced 3D human tissue models into toxicology testing workflows, this initiative can bridge the divide between animal testing and human biology.

Which Region Commands The Largest Share Of The In-Vitro Toxicology Testing Market?
North America was the largest region in the in- vitro toxicology testing market in 2025. Asia-Pacific is expected to be the fastest-growing region in the in- vitro toxicology testing market report during the forecast period. The regions covered in the in-vitro toxicology testing market report are Asia-Pacific, South East Asia, Western Europe, Eastern Europe, North America, South America, Middle East, Africa.
